President Joe Biden’s management is wanting to money initiatives that enhance semiconductor production by utilizing electronic doubles.

Digital doubles are online designs utilized to examine and maximize physical things and systems. As an example, auto manufacturers are looking to use digital twins of their factories to trying out brand-new production procedures without interrupting manufacturing.

The Biden management revealed will certainly be approving applications of what it expects to be a total amount of $285 million in financing for job that consists of research study right into semiconductor electronic twin advancement, structure and sustaining consolidated physical/digital centers, sector presentation tasks, labor force training, and procedure of what it states will certainly be a brand-new CHIPS Production U.S.A. Institute.

Throughout a press instruction Sunday, Under Assistant of Business for Requirements and Innovation and National Institute of Requirements and Innovation Supervisor Laurie E. Locascio claimed electronic doubles can decrease chip advancement and production expenses, while likewise making it possible for even more collective procedures around chip style and advancement.

” Presently, no nation has actually spent at the range required or effectively linked the sector to open the substantial capacity of electronic twin innovation for advancement explorations,” Locascio claimed.

This financing becomes part of the CHIPS and Scientific Research Act of 2022, a $280 billion costs that included $52.7 billion to increase domestic semiconductor manufacturing. At the time, Head of state Biden kept in mind that the USA had actually gone from creating 40 percent of semiconductors worldwide to much less than 10 percent.

Resembling one more significant style in the administration’s rhetoric, Aide to the Head Of State for Scientific Research and Innovation and Supervisor of the White Home Workplace of Scientific Research and Innovation Plan Arati Prabhakar claimed Sunday that when the CHIPS Act was passed, semiconductor production had actually come to be “hazardously focused in simply one component of the globe” (most likely describing China).

There will certainly be an informational webinar concerning applications on May 8. Organizations that can use consist of nonprofits, colleges, federal governments, and for-profit business that are “residential entities” (included in the USA, with their major business right here).
